Jon Speaks to the Late Show

The Late Show with Jason McCrossan interviewed Jon Cruddas MP. Jon and Jason discussed the Housing Shortage, the new prison which is planned for Dagenham, the rise of the BNP and the current Labour leadership troubles.

The Late Show Broadcasts every Thursday night on Link 92.2FM between 9pm and 12am.

Government Announces £500 Million for New Affordable Houses

Jon welcomes news that Housing Minister John Healey has announced a boost to housebuilding in England, by confirming nearly £500 million funding to build around 8,000 affordable homes across the country including your local authority area. This takes total Government funding for housebuilding to over £3.3 billion since June.

Prison plan crushed

Plans to dump a 1,500 place Prison on Dagenham have been thrown out by the government after a massive local campaign against it.
